Dracaena leaves that sag or bend downwards often indicate the plant is experiencing stress. This loss of rigidity is a common signal that its needs are not being met. While concerning, drooping is frequently a reversible condition, prompting owners to investigate environmental or care issues.
Understanding Why Dracaena Leaves Droop
When a dracaena experiences prolonged dryness, it reduces turgor pressure within its leaf cells to conserve moisture. This causes the leaves to become limp and droop as the internal water pressure, which normally keeps them firm, diminishes.
Conversely, excess water can lead to root rot. Saturated conditions deprive roots of oxygen, causing them to decay and lose their ability to absorb water. Despite wet soil, the plant becomes dehydrated, manifesting as drooping leaves because water cannot reach the foliage.
Inadequate or excessive light exposure also impacts leaf structure. Insufficient light can lead to weak, leggy growth, with leaves unable to maintain their upright form. Direct, intense sunlight can scorch leaves, causing cell damage and loss of rigidity.
Extreme temperatures stress dracaena plants. Exposure to cold drafts or temperatures below 50°F (10°C) can shock the plant, causing leaves to sag. High temperatures or proximity to heat sources can also lead to rapid moisture loss and wilting.
Low ambient humidity causes dracaena leaves to transpire too quickly, losing moisture faster than roots can absorb it. This rapid water loss decreases internal water pressure, causing foliage to become limp and droop. Leaf edges may also crisp.
A lack of essential nutrients weakens the dracaena’s overall structure. When the plant cannot access vital elements like nitrogen or potassium, its ability to maintain healthy cell development is compromised. This deficiency can cause drooping or discolored leaves.
Pests, such as spider mites or mealybugs, feed by sucking sap, depleting the plant’s fluids and energy. This weakens its internal structure, leading to drooping leaves. Fungal or bacterial diseases can also impair the plant’s vascular system, hindering water transport and causing wilting.
Transplanting or repotting places stress on a dracaena’s root system. During this transition, root damage is common, temporarily impairing the plant’s ability to absorb water. This can lead to transplant shock, causing leaves to droop until roots recover and re-establish themselves.
Steps to Revive a Drooping Dracaena
To address underwatering, thoroughly drench the soil until water drains from the pot’s bottom, ensuring the entire root ball is moistened. Before subsequent waterings, insert your finger about two inches deep; if it feels dry, water again.
If overwatering is suspected, remove the dracaena to inspect roots for rot, such as mushy or dark sections. Trim affected roots with clean scissors, then repot into fresh, well-draining mix. Ensure the pot has adequate drainage holes.
If light is the issue, move the dracaena to bright, indirect light, such as a few feet from a south or west-facing window. Protect the plant from direct afternoon sun, which can scorch its leaves. For low light, consider supplementing with a grow light.
To mitigate temperature stress, relocate your dracaena away from cold drafts or heat sources. Maintain a consistent room temperature, ideally between 65°F and 75°F (18°C and 24°C).
Increasing ambient humidity benefits a dracaena showing signs of moisture loss. Place the potted plant on a pebble tray filled with water, ensuring the pot does not sit directly in it. Alternatively, use a room humidifier or group plants together.
For nutrient deficiencies, apply a balanced liquid houseplant fertilizer diluted to half strength every two to four weeks during the spring and summer growing season. Avoid fertilizing during the plant’s dormant period in fall and winter.
If pests are present, wipe leaves with a damp cloth or spray with insecticidal soap, ensuring to cover both the top and underside. Repeat applications as directed until controlled. For suspected diseases, remove affected leaves and ensure good air circulation.
After repotting or transplanting, provide consistent, moderate moisture and avoid direct, harsh sunlight for a few weeks. This allows the plant’s roots to recover and adjust to their new environment. Misting the leaves lightly can also help reduce transpiration during this recovery period.
Preventing Future Drooping
Establishing a consistent watering routine is important for preventing future leaf drooping. Always check the soil moisture before watering, ensuring the top inch or two is dry to the touch, which helps avoid both underwatering and overwatering. Proper drainage in the pot is equally important to prevent waterlogged conditions.
Placing your dracaena in an area that receives bright, indirect light consistently throughout the day promotes healthy growth. Protecting the plant from sudden temperature fluctuations and maintaining a stable indoor environment, ideally within its preferred range, minimizes environmental stress.
Regularly assessing humidity levels, especially during dry seasons or in heated homes, allows for proactive adjustments like using a humidifier or pebble tray. Periodically inspecting the plant’s leaves and stems for early signs of pests or discolored foliage enables timely intervention before issues become severe. Observing your plant’s overall appearance and making consistent adjustments to its care routine helps prevent stress-related drooping.
